Profile

Lindley’s research program centers on how contexts support individual well-being to foster personal growth, motivation, and behavior change. She uses universal psychological tenants to design evaluation protocols focused on systems of change that support desirable intra- and inter-personal, and organizational well-being through positive social interactions. She challenges partners to consider the range of influences from the individual to the larger cultural context to develop actionable evidence-based plans for intervention to understand and promote lasting change. Lindley applies advanced statistical methods including longitudinal growth models, multilevel models and other structural equation modeling methods, and qualitative research methods as fitting for each project.
